What Is the Easiest Way from Incheon Airport to L7 Myeongdong?

Quick answer: For the easiest trip with luggage, take airport limousine bus 6001 from Incheon Airport Terminal 1 or Terminal 2 and get off at Myeong-dong Station (Exit 4). L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E is about a 4-minute walk from the stop. The train is cheaper and usually faster, but requires a transfer at Seoul Station.

Are you staying at L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E? This guide explains the practical route from both Incheon Airport terminals, including the airport bus, AREX train, the final walk, and an important elevator tip for travelers with luggage.

Terminal 1 to L7 Myeongdong: Airport bus 6001

  1. After immigration and baggage claim, go to the Arrival Lobby on the 1st floor.
  2. Find the airport bus stop and board bus 6001.
  3. Ride approximately 9 stops. The sample NAVER Map search showed about 1 hour 22 minutes on the bus.
  4. Get off at Myeong-dong Station (Exit 4).
  5. Walk about four minutes to L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E.

The sample route showed a total journey of approximately 1 hour 26 minutes and a fare of ₩17,000.

Terminal 2 to L7 Myeongdong: Airport bus 6001

  1. From Terminal 2, follow the signs to the airport bus area on B1.
  2. The sample route included a walk of about 199 metres (4 minutes) to the boarding point.
  3. Board airport bus 6001.
  4. Ride approximately 10 stops.
  5. Get off at Myeong-dong Station (Exit 4).

The sample search showed about 1 hour 52 minutes in total and a fare of ₩17,000. Traffic can make the trip longer, especially during rush hour.

Cheaper alternative: AREX and Subway Line 4

  1. Take the Airport Railroad from your terminal toward Seoul.
  2. Get off at Seoul Station.
  3. Transfer to Subway Line 4 toward Myeong-dong.
  4. Get off at Myeong-dong Station.

From Terminal 2, the sample NAVER Map results showed a regular rail option of about 1 hour 28 minutes and ₩5,350. A faster, more expensive option was approximately 1 hour 16 minutes and ₩14,550. The transfer at Seoul Station can involve a long walk, so the direct bus is usually easier with large suitcases.

How do I walk from Myeong-dong Station to L7 Myeongdong?

Exit 4 is the closest exit. The NAVER Map walking route showed approximately 4 minutes and about 200 metres.

  1. Use Exit 4 at Myeong-dong Station.
  2. Cross the first crosswalk.
  3. Turn right.
  4. Cross again toward the A Twosome Place/L7 side.
  5. Continue straight to L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E.

Luggage and elevator tip: Exit 4 is closest to the hotel, but it requires stairs. After leaving the train, look for platform marker 10-4 and follow the elevator signs. Continue following elevator signs toward street level. The step-free exit may place you slightly farther from the hotel, but it is a better choice with heavy luggage, a stroller, or a wheelchair.

What should I enter in NAVER Map?

  • Starting point: Incheon International Airport Terminal 1 or Terminal 2
  • Destination: L7 MYEONGDONG by LOTTE HOTELS
  • Check both the Bus and Subway tabs.
  • Confirm the terminal, departure time, bus stop and live service information before boarding.

Final recommendation

Choose bus 6001 if you want the simplest route and are carrying luggage. Choose AREX plus Line 4 if price or predictable travel time matters more and you can manage the Seoul Station transfer. For more help using Korean buses, see our guide to riding buses in Korea.

Route information can change. Check NAVER Map and official airport transportation information on your travel day.

How Do I Find L7 Myeongdong on NAVER Map?

Google Maps can be less reliable for detailed walking directions in South Korea. NAVER Map is usually more useful for checking the correct hotel entrance, subway exit and final walking route.

  1. Open the NAVER Map app.
  2. Make sure the app menu is displayed in English.
  3. Tap “Search on NAVER Maps”.
  4. Enter L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E.
  5. Check that the address is 137 Toegye-ro, Jung-gu, Seoul and that the hotel is beside Myeongdong Station.
  6. Tap Directions.
  7. Set your starting point as Incheon International Airport Terminal 1 or Terminal 2.
  8. Select Transit to compare the airport bus and train routes.

Important: Select the terminal where your flight arrives. Terminal 1 and Terminal 2 have different bus boarding areas and train travel times.

Route 2: AREX + Subway Line 4 — Most Predictable

This route avoids most road traffic, but the transfer at Seoul Station can involve a fairly long walk. Allow extra time if you have heavy luggage.

Step-by-step

  1. At Incheon Airport, follow the signs for Airport Railroad (AREX).
  2. Take either the AREX Express Train or the All-Stop Train to Seoul Station.
  3. At Seoul Station, follow signs for Subway Line 4.
  4. Take Line 4 toward Jin접 / Myeongdong.
  5. Get off at Myeongdong Station, two stops from Seoul Station.
  6. Follow signs for Exit 9. Check the elevator information in NAVER Map if stairs are difficult.
  7. After reaching street level, search L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E again and choose Directions → Walk.

The total trip normally takes about 60–80 minutes, depending on your terminal, train waiting time and the transfer at Seoul Station.

Common mistake: Do not confuse Myeongdong Station on Line 4 with Euljiro 1-ga Station on Line 2. L7 Myeongdong is closest to Myeongdong Station.

Route 3: Taxi — Best for Families or Late Arrivals

Show the driver the Korean hotel name and address below. Keeping the Korean text on your phone reduces confusion:

롯데호텔 L7 명동
서울특별시 중구 퇴계로 137
L7 Myeongdong by LOTTE
137 Toegye-ro, Jung-gu, Seoul

Travel time is often about 60–90 minutes, but it can be longer during heavy traffic. The fare varies with traffic, terminal, tolls and late-night surcharges. Use the official airport taxi stand and avoid unsolicited ride offers inside the terminal.
